The Digital Pathology National Sales Manager for Leica Biosystems is responsible for the achievement of targets, strategy, budget, business development, projects, DBS and People Management,


This position is part of the Digital Pathology Commercial team located in META and will be fully remote.  At Leica Biosystems, our vision is to advance cancer diagnostics and improve lives.


You will be a part of the Digital Pathology Commercial team and report to the Sr. Commercial Director, Digital Pathology responsible for owning the digital pathology strategy, development of the strategy to drive growth and goals for the META Region.  If you thrive in a fast paced role and want to work to build a world-class commercial organization—read on.


In this role, you will:


  • Focus on the achievement of targets, strategy, budget, business development, projects, DBS and People Management,
    •    Lead coach, mentor and support a team of Digital Pathology Sales Specialist and Application Consultants and Account Managers when needed, to enable the development inclusion and retention of direct reports. 
    •    Travel with associates providing individual coaching and professional development (target 3 days per week or 60% of available time)
    •    Build a strong network to strategic customers and be actively involved in regional DP sales projects
    •    Develop and lead change management initiatives across the organization
    •    Defining and lead new ways of working
    •    Engage and lead the team to achieve and exceed individual quarterly and annual sales quota, strategic and sales objectives
    •    Lead all engagement activity for the team
    •    Lead by example as a people manager for LBS EMEA that includes all leadership core behaviours engagement, and other people related activities, e.g. P4G, D4G
    •    Ensure all people related activity is completed for the team
    •    Develop, maintain and implement development plans for all direct reports
    •    Recruit, develop and train your team with clearly communicated sales and overall performance standards
    •    Establish Standards of Performance for direct reports and set expectations on completion of responsibilities and duties
    •    Lead EMEA projects as required
    •    Apply DBS tools as daily work. Implement visual management for entire sales team
    •    Drive at the country level the Digital Pathology sales funnel in collaboration with the Digital Pathology national team and the AM team.
    •    Lead the tender response process as applicable, in collaboration with DP team and other resources as applicable 

The essential requirements of the job include:


  • Proven track record of sustained understanding and knowledge of Healthcare Sector, introducing complex IT, workflow-changing solutions to Healthcare/Life Science customers
  • Sales and Project Management experience as well as experience in managing a team
  • Significant Experience in complex multistakeholder sales as well as managing and defining Customer Service Strategy
  • Ability to prioritize and focus. Self-starter, highly organized: able to set up and maintain new processes within a dynamic organization. Able to learn quickly demonstrates agility, about a new clinical space and industry, identify and work with key players, leverages past learnings. Has the ability to simplify and drive action sometimes without all the data necessary to make a decision
  • Experience in solving Problems. Attention to detail with strong project management, resource planning, and analytical skills leading to consistent on-time delivery of high-quality creative assets, ability to apply PSP tools, recommending process-based countermeasures
